The fabricator operates fabricating machines such as welders, plasma cutters, cutoff saws, drill presses, forming machines, and punches that cut, shape, and bend metal plates, sheets, tubes, and structures by performing the following duties. Assist in the fabrication of hydraulic power units. Operate various shop equipment (drill press, band saw, MIG Welder, grinders, hand tools, etc.) Perform general assembly and kitting of fluid power systems and components. Bend hydraulic tubing and make hydraulic hoses per spec. Read and interpret fluid power and electrical schematics. Operate hydraulic test stand and other test equipment for quality control. Paint, pack, and ship hydraulic components and complete any necessary paperwork. Properly handle all waste materials. Perform other assignments at the direction of departmental supervision. Obey all safety rules and perform housekeeping functions as required Participate in continuous improvement through training and associate development. Performs minor machine maintenance such as oiling machines, dies, or workpieces. Operates any equipment needed to perform the job.
